You are here

function biblio_advanced_import_update_hash in Biblio Advanced Import 7

Same name and namespace in other branches
  1. 6 biblio_advanced_import.module \biblio_advanced_import_update_hash()

Helper function to update the hash of a biblio node.

Parameters

$node: a biblio node

See also

biblio_advanced_import_settings_form()

3 calls to biblio_advanced_import_update_hash()
biblio_advanced_import_node_insert in ./biblio_advanced_import.module
Implements hook_node_insert().
biblio_advanced_import_node_update in ./biblio_advanced_import.module
Implements hook_node_update().
biblio_advanced_import_update_hashes_batch in ./biblio_advanced_import.batch.inc
Updates the hashes of all biblio nodes as batch process.

File

./biblio_advanced_import.module, line 280
Biblio add-on.

Code

function biblio_advanced_import_update_hash(&$node) {
  $node->biblio_md5 = biblio_advanced_import_hash($node);
  db_update('biblio')
    ->fields(array(
    'biblio_md5' => $node->biblio_md5,
  ))
    ->condition('nid', $node->nid)
    ->condition('vid', $node->vid)
    ->execute();
}